📖Generation guide
Type 4S R8 V10 Plus • 2015-2018
Featuring a 5.2L FSI V10 engine producing 610hp, this model is known for its quattro AWD and is built on a shared platform with the Lamborghini Huracan at Audi Sport's Neckarsulm facility.
Type 4S R8 V10 Performance • 2019-2024
A facelifted version offering up to 630hp, including special variants like the Decennium 50-unit edition and rear-wheel-drive Performance models, all with enhanced performance attributes.
RWD Performance • 2020-2024
This variant emphasizes a lightweight feel and rear-wheel dynamics, appealing to purists and collectors alike, representing a unique shift in R8 performance.
Spyder • 2016-2024
The open-top variant of the R8, providing a unique driving experience, with collector value increasing for rare color combinations and the limited-edition Decennium variant.
Known issues by generation
The Audi R8 V10 Plus, while a marvel of engineering, comes with specific maintenance considerations. The 5.2L FSI V10 engine, sharing its block with the Lamborghini Huracan, requires careful attention to timing-chain and tensioner inspections, particularly between 80,000 to 120,000 miles, and can incur costs between $4,000 to $8,000 for preventive service. Additionally, carbon buildup on intake valves necessitates walnut-blasting, costing $1,500 to $2,500 every 40,000 to 60,000 miles. Transmission wear may also affect high-mileage track-day vehicles, with clutch pack rebuilds ranging from $4,000 to $8,000. Recognizing these issues is crucial for prospective donors, as maintaining comprehensive service records enhances the vehicle's value immensely.
Donation value by condition + generation
The market for the Audi R8 V10 Plus is increasingly appreciating, especially as the last naturally aspirated V10 supercar from Audi. Vehicles in pristine condition, with full service records and original paint, can command prices between $130,000 and $200,000. Unique variants like the RWD Performance and the limited Decennium edition are above $200,000, especially those in original colors like Suzuka Grey and Vegas Yellow. Maintaining factory-of-origin authentication and documentation of preventive services is essential in establishing value, as collectors actively seek well-documented and preserved examples.
Donation process for this model
Donating your Audi R8 V10 Plus to Badger Auto Aid involves several important steps. Given the vehicle's high value, a qualified appraisal is strongly recommended to comply with IRS Form 8283 Section B appraisal requirements, especially as values can exceed the $5,000 threshold significantly. We recommend using enclosed climate-controlled transport for delivery, ensuring your vehicle's safety throughout the process. Essential documentation includes the factory-of-origin build plate, service history receipts, and matching engine/chassis VINs to validate authenticity.
